Meaning

Rotor stator homogenizers, also known as high shear mixers, are mechanical devices used for the homogenization, emulsification, dispersion, and mixing of substances in liquid or semi-solid forms. Consisting of a rotor rotating inside a stationary stator, rotor stator homogenizers generate high shear forces and turbulence, effectively breaking down particles and achieving uniform mixing and blending of ingredients. Rotor stator homogenizers find applications across various industries, including pharmaceuticals, food and beverage, cosmetics, chemicals, and biotechnology, enabling efficient and scalable production processes.

Category-wise Insights

Each category of rotor stator homogenizers offers unique features, benefits, and applications tailored to the specific needs and requirements of industries across sectors:

  • Batch Homogenizers: Batch homogenizers are versatile mixing systems designed for small to medium-scale production processes, enabling efficient mixing, blending, and homogenization of ingredients in liquid or semi-solid forms.
  • Inline Homogenizers: Inline homogenizers are continuous mixing systems used for large-scale production processes, enabling high-throughput processing, consistent product quality, and real-time process monitoring and control.
